This is an easy-to-read guide for mentors, mentees, professors of business, and business graduates is a must-read for all professionals written by a retired senior manager. Although intended for a business audience, the advice in this book is appropriate for employers and employees from any discipline. With chapter headings like Teaming and Trust, Communication, Humanity in Business, and The Bottom Line; Work Hard, Do Right, and Have Fun, it is apparent that this man understands what motivates people to do their best work and how to communicate his ideas to employers and employees alike.

Acerca del autor

Collins Andrews has helped build some of the country’s fastest-growing companies, including Systematics, Inc. and Alltel Information Services, Inc., where he retired from senior management. A graduate of the Stonier Graduate School of Banking at Rutgers University, Andrews earned his undergraduate degree from Vanderbilt and an advanced degree from Purdue. He is a member of the Arkansas Executive Forum and a recent inductee into the Arkansas Academy of Computing. Andrews live in Little Rock, Arkansas, where he is a frequent lecturer for leadership and management training programs. He heads Andrews Consulting, LLC.
